Course Overview
HiQual UK delivers the Level 2 Award in Basic Food Hygiene program, designed to provide food handlers and catering staff with the essential knowledge and skills to maintain hygiene and safety in food preparation and service. It emphasizes personal hygiene, safe food handling, cleaning practices, and compliance with food safety regulations. Participants will gain the competence to work safely in catering, retail, and hospitality environments while protecting consumer health.

Introduction to Food Hygiene Importance of hygiene in food handling and consumer protection.
-
Food Safety Legislation and Responsibilities Legal requirements, employer/employee responsibilities, and enforcement.
-
Microbiological Hazards and Foodborne Illnesses Common pathogens, contamination routes, and prevention methods.
-
Personal Hygiene in Food Handling Handwashing, protective clothing, and illness reporting.
-
Food Storage and Temperature Control Safe storage, refrigeration, freezing, and cooking/reheating practices.
-
Cross‑Contamination and Allergen Awareness Preventing cross‑contact, allergen labeling, and safe practices.
-
Cleaning and Disinfection Cleaning schedules, sanitization methods, and safe use of chemicals.
-
Food Premises and Equipment Hygiene Maintaining hygienic facilities, equipment, and work surfaces.
-
Pest Control in Food Environments Identifying pests, prevention measures, and reporting procedures.
-
Safe Practices in Catering and Retail Practical application of hygiene principles in real work settings.
